The gastric sleeve procedure, formally called sleeve gastrectomy, removes roughly 75 to 80 percent of the stomach, leaving a slim, banana-shaped tube. It is purely restrictive in the mechanical sense, meaning the smaller stomach holds less food, but it also does something metabolic: removing the upper portion of the stomach lowers production of ghrelin, the main hunger hormone. Patients feel full sooner and, importantly, feel hungry less often. There is no rerouting of the intestines.
The gastric bypass surgery, formally the Roux-en-Y gastric bypass, does two things. It creates a small stomach pouch, and it reroutes the small intestine so that food bypasses part of it. That combination reduces how much you can eat and changes how calories and nutrients are absorbed, while also producing powerful shifts in gut hormones. Bypass has been performed for decades and is often considered the reference standard against which other procedures are measured. Both procedures are generally considered for adults with a body mass index of 40 or higher, or 35 or higher with an obesity-related condition such as type 2 diabetes, high blood pressure, or sleep apnea. Within that shared eligibility, several factors push the recommendation one way or the other.
This is why candidacy is not a checkbox. Two patients with identical BMIs can receive different recommendations because of what else is going on with their health.
Both operations produce substantial, durable weight loss, and the difference between them is smaller than many people expect. On average, sleeve patients lose roughly 60 to 65 percent of their excess body weight over the first year to eighteen months, while bypass patients tend to lose slightly more, often in the range of 65 to 75 percent. These are averages, not guarantees, and the range within each procedure is wide.
What matters more than the headline percentages is that both procedures dramatically outperform diet, exercise, and medication alone for people with significant obesity, and that the results hold for years when patients follow the nutrition and follow-up plan. If there is one clinical issue that frequently tips the decision, it is acid reflux. The sleeve can worsen or trigger gastroesophageal reflux disease in some patients, because the narrow stomach tube can increase pressure and allow acid to move upward. For someone who already has significant heartburn or a hiatal hernia, that is a meaningful concern.
The bypass, by contrast, tends to improve reflux, and it is often the recommended choice specifically for patients with pre-existing GERD. This single factor is one of the most common reasons a surgeon steers a reflux-prone patient toward bypass rather than sleeve, even when the patient arrived assuming they wanted the simpler operation.
Both procedures improve type 2 diabetes, often dramatically, but the bypass generally has the edge on remission. Because it reroutes the intestine and produces stronger gut-hormone changes, blood sugar frequently improves within days of surgery, sometimes before meaningful weight is lost. Long-term trial evidence, including the widely cited five-year STAMPEDE results published in the New England Journal of Medicine, showed that surgery combined with medical therapy achieved better glycemic control than medical therapy alone, with strong outcomes for bypass.
The sleeve also improves diabetes and is an excellent metabolic operation in its own right. For a patient whose primary concern is longstanding, hard-to-control diabetes, though, the bypass is frequently the stronger tool.
Recovery timelines for the two procedures are broadly similar. Most patients stay in the hospital one to two nights, return to desk work within one to two weeks, and progress through a staged diet that moves from liquids to purees to soft foods and finally to regular textures over several weeks. Both require a permanent commitment to smaller portions, adequate protein, and daily vitamins.
The nutritional demands differ in degree. Because the bypass changes absorption, it carries a somewhat higher lifelong need for vitamin and mineral supplementation and closer monitoring for deficiencies. The sleeve still requires supplements and follow-up, but the absorption pathway remains intact, which some patients find simpler to manage over decades.
Neither operation should be thought of as easily undone. The sleeve is not reversible, because the removed portion of the stomach is gone. The bypass is technically reversible in rare circumstances, but it is a complex operation that is not intended to be undone and is only considered for serious complications.
What is more relevant for most patients is revision. If weight is regained years later, or if a complication develops, a sleeve can sometimes be converted to a bypass, and other bariatric revision surgery options exist depending on the situation. For milder weight regain, some patients add GLP-1 and semaglutide support rather than returning to the operating room. Knowing that a path forward exists, even if it is rarely needed, gives many patients peace of mind as they choose their first procedure.
Losing a large amount of weight changes your whole body, and many patients are left with loose or excess skin once the weight is gone. This is normal and worth anticipating. After weight has stabilized, some patients pursue body contouring after major weight loss to remove excess skin and refine the final shape. Thinking about that chapter in advance helps you picture the entire journey rather than just the operating room.
The honest takeaway is that sleeve and bypass are both excellent, and the right answer is specific to you. Your BMI, your reflux history, whether you have diabetes and how severe it is, your other medical conditions, and your own preferences all feed into the recommendation. A thorough consultation is where those pieces come together.
